# Function dot

Calculate the dot product of two vectors. The dot product of
`A = [a1, a2, ..., an]` and `B = [b1, b2, ..., bn]` is defined as:

   dot(A, B) = conj(a1) * b1 + conj(a2) * b2 + ... + conj(an) * bn


## Syntax

```js
math.dot(x, y)
```

### Parameters

Parameter | Type | Description
--------- | ---- | -----------
`x` | Array &#124; Matrix | First vector
`y` | Array &#124; Matrix | Second vector

### Returns

Type | Description
---- | -----------
number | Returns the dot product of `x` and `y`


## Examples

```js
math.dot([2, 4, 1], [2, 2, 3])       // returns number 15
math.multiply([2, 4, 1], [2, 2, 3])  // returns number 15
```
